NPA generates N172.285bn in six months, remits N78.496bn to Federation account
These figures were contained in a half-year 2022 operational report released by the authority.
“Global economic and inflation crises, global reduction in household incomes and purchasing power and scarcity of foreign exchange all of which has negatively affected business environment, affected Government revenue and constrained expenditure.
“The Authority remains committed to providing improved services to increase efficiency at the ports that impact on higher revenue generation and economic growth of the nation.”
He listed such improved services to increase efficiency at the ports to include: deployment of marine crafts at all ports locations; marking/laying of buoys at Calabar and Escravos Channel to improve safe navigation; encouraging the use of Eastern Port by way of incentives to importers on port charges; deployment of security patrol boats to increase safety along the Port Quays; and repairs/ rehabilitation of ports’ access roads to improve cargo evacuation and dwell time.
Others, he said, were encouraging the use of barges for cargo evacuation to reduce traffic gridlock on the roads; licensing of export processing terminals in order to support the Federal Government’s initiative to increase non-oil exports; creating MSS for barge operations in order to improve multi-modal means of cargo movement; and, working on initiatives to improve on staff members’ welfare.
